WebAug 24, 2024 · Impaired osmoregulation may also explain why your fish are swimming erratically and acting stressed after a water change. This weird behavior may even be accompanied by spasms. To find out whether the drastic change in Nitrate stressed your fish you could use a liquid water test kit before and after replacing the aquarium water.

WebAlso, as you are showing both ammonia (NH3) and nitrite (NO2-), this means that something is off with your cycle. Both the ammonia and the nitrite are toxic to your fish, and this is surely causing much of the … WebAnswer (1 of 3): There could be any number of reasons, to be honest.
